Replacement Drive Head for RV Awning that Won't Stay Open
Updated 09/12/2025 | Published 05/25/2025 >
Question:
I have a 2017 Clipper Cadet with a Solera manual awning. When you try to open the awning it will not stay open, I think something is broken, as you pull it it just wants to roll back up. Would it be the Drive head, part LC272067 or the idler head, LC285147 need to be replaced, or both? How hard is it to replace these parts? Thank you for any input you have in this matter.
asked by: Alan K
Expert Reply:
Hey Alan, that would indicate a problem with the awning drive head so you'd want to replace it with the part # LC272067. This is not a difficult install. When installing the Solera Manual Pull Style Awning Drive Head, Black # LC272067 you will want the spring to be under some tension when completing the installation so that it draws the awning back fully once you've completed the installation. My contact at Lippert mentioned you'll want to secure the awning arm before removing the head and un-fastening the screw that keeps it attached to the arm. You can then pull the awning out slightly, install the head and then fasten everything back up.
